Take a Look Inside



Spare me the words
driven by emotion.

Impassivity of the mind is optimal for logical thinking,
sensitivity leaves room only for inconvenience,
take advantage of what you lack,
those around can see your sin,
they’re peering in and tearing at your insides.

Self-awareness is a curse and a blessing,
though I need not the blessings from above,
the entities claim to preach acceptance and tranquility,
yet in the times of most need,
it won’t spare you even a whisper of a word,
it will leave you behind.

Don’t listen to the chatter in your head,
unless what they say is right.
It’s up to you to decide now.

Do I need to be saved?
How can I be healed?

Spare me your words.

About this poem

I'm describing myself and some of my most inner deep thoughts. This is mostly about me being an apathetic person and not understanding why those around me have so much emotion put into the decisions they make daily. It also has some hidden meaning behind it; specifically about manipulation. Also this talks about my experience with religion and how I perceive it.
